After months of speculation and delays, Take-Two CEO Strauss Zelnick has once again confirmed that Grand Theft Auto 6 (GTA 6), developed by Rockstar Games, is set to launch on November 19, 2026. This confirmation comes in an interview with YouTuber David Senra, aimed at easing fears of another potential delay. Originally slated for a 2025 release, GTA 6 was first delayed to May 26, 2026, and then pushed back again to its current November release date.

The reconfirmation, while reassuring, does little to alleviate the frustration stemming from the lack of new information about the game. Compounding this frustration was the recent pre-order debacle. Last week, a leak from major retailer Best Buy suggested that GTA 6 pre-orders would go live on May 18, sparking hopes for an accompanying trailer or gameplay reveal. However, the anticipated announcement did not materialize, with Rockstar Games maintaining silence on its usual social media posting schedule.
Pre-Order Confusion and Community Reaction
An internal email from another retailer, shared on GTA Forums, indicated that Best Buy's pre-order leak was incorrect, and no pre-orders would be launched on May 18. This news has left the community in a state of exhaustion and heightened anticipation. As expressed by many fans and echoed in gaming media, the prolonged wait for any substantial update on GTA 6 is wearing thin. The community's reaction is a mix of relief that the release date seems firm and frustration over the continued secrecy surrounding the game's details.

What This Means for Fans and the Gaming Industry
The repeated delays and now the pre-order confusion underscore the challenges in managing expectations for highly anticipated titles. For GTA 6, the stakes are exceptionally high given the franchise's impact on the gaming industry. The confirmation of the November 19 release date provides a clear target for fans, but the silence on pre-orders and game details suggests that Rockstar Games is maintaining its traditional approach of revealing information on its own terms.
With Summer Game Fest and other gaming showcases approaching in June, speculation is rife that GTA 6 might finally get the spotlight it has been lacking. For fans and industry watchers alike, the next few weeks could be crucial in shedding more light on what promises to be one of the most significant game releases in recent history.
